笔记68:Pytorch中repeat函数的用法

repeat 相当于一个broadcasting的机制

repeat(*sizes)

沿着指定的维度重复tensor。不同与expand(),本函数复制的是tensor中的数据。

python 复制代码
import torch
import torch.nn.functional as F
import numpy as np
a = torch.Tensor(128,1,512)
B = a.repeat(1,5,1)
print(B.shape)
python 复制代码
torch.Size([128, 5, 512])

转自:pytorch repeat的用法-CSDN博客

相关推荐
庞轩px20 分钟前
内存区域的演进与直接内存——JVM性能优化的权衡艺术
java·jvm·笔记·性能优化
liangshanbo12151 小时前
大模型 RAG 向量数据工程全链路架构笔记
笔记·架构
罗罗攀1 小时前
PyTorch学习笔记|张量的广播和科学运算
人工智能·pytorch·笔记·python·学习
左左右右左右摇晃1 小时前
Java 笔记--OOM产生原因以及解决方法
java·笔记
ShiJiuD6668889992 小时前
mysql 基础笔记一
数据库·笔记·mysql
2501_926978333 小时前
“术“与“道“的平衡---“缺失“与“完整”的统一
经验分享·笔记·ai写作
智者知已应修善业3 小时前
【51单片机用两个定时计数器级联实现定时】2023-04-12
c语言·经验分享·笔记·算法·51单片机
中屹指纹浏览器4 小时前
2026高并发多账号运营下指纹浏览器性能调优与工程化实践
经验分享·笔记